Hi there, On Tue, 19 Jun 2018, Andrew McGlashan wrote:
... The clamav SPF record also doesn't have an "all" value, which should be the last entry for each record. ...
There is an implicit '?all' mechanism for any SPF record which does not have one explicitly set by the record author or by the content of a 'redirect' modifier - see section 4.7 of RFC7208 (but I'd agree that it's better to state a policy explicitly).
... many SPF records are just plain wrong, or how many have more than 1 entry (having only 1 is valid, more than 1 is a fail) ...
More than 1 gives 'permerror', not 'fail' (see section 4.5), although I suppose you may choose to treat the two results identically. :) -- 73, Ged. _______________________________________________ clamav-users mailing list clamav-users@lists.clamav.net http://lists.clamav.net/cgi-bin/mailman/listinfo/clamav-users Help us build a comprehensive ClamAV guide: https://github.com/vrtadmin/clamav-faq http://www.clamav.net/contact.html#ml